Sorry for the mistake.I am having a difficult time finding a flywheel (officially called a "ROTOR & STARTER PAWL" on the Homelite site) for a Super 2, Model# UT-10734AR. It is one of the last models of Super 2 with the plastic case and gas primer bulb integrated into the gas cap. The part# for the "ROTOR & STARTER PAWL" is listed as an A04158 in the Homelite IPL and shows "Part is No Longer Available (and none in stock)" if you try to order it. I found the flywheel from other Super 2 models does not appear to work on this particular model as they don't stick out far enough to engage the starter pawls and the ignition is different. most of these part numbers were changed changed when john deere screwed i mean bought the company in 96. any super 2 flywheel would work as it is for an electronic coil. ck in with a local saw shop and see if the have a saw graveyard you could look through.

I'm with Todd, My books show a xl-2 0r super 2 to be the same as long as your using a solid state ignition rotor with a solid state ignition. The point ignition takes a different rotor,which fits the point ignition only

If the new flywheel, you obtained, fits your saw and the recoil pulley does not fit then change the recoil pulley, it is an easy job to do. I have found that the flywheels from the older ignition points saws work fine with the newer pointless systems. Make sure the flywheel magnets match up with the poles on the coil. Use a 3X5 File Card to set the air gap. I have the pulleys if you need one.
